Your Self-Install Kit has arrived! You can set up your new internet service in just a few simple steps without needing a technician.
What's in the Box:
- (1) Modem/Router
- (1) Power Cord
- (1) Coax Cable (the round one)
- (1) Ethernet Cable (optional)
Step-by-Step Installation
- Find the Wall Outlet: Locate the active coax (cable) outlet in your wall. This is the same type of round connection used for cable TV.
- Connect the Coax Cable: Screw one end of the coax cable into the wall outlet until it's "finger-tight." Screw the other end into the back of your new modem.
- Connect the Power: Plug the power cord into the back of the modem, and plug the other end into a nearby electrical outlet.
- Wait for the Lights: The modem will now turn on and boot up. This is the most important step. It can take 5 to 10 minutes as it connects to our network and downloads updates.
- Watch the "Online" Light: The lights on the front will blink. Wait until the "Online" or "@" light turns solid (not blinking). This means your modem is successfully connected to the internet.
How to Connect to Your New WiFi
Once the "Online" light is solid:
- Find the sticker on the back or bottom of your new modem.
- You will see the Default WiFi Name (SSID) and Password.
- On your phone or computer, go to your WiFi settings, find that network name, and connect using the password from the sticker.
You are now online!
Troubleshooting: If the "Online" light is still blinking after 15 minutes, try this:
- Make sure the coax cable is screwed in tightly at both ends.
- Try a different coax wall outlet if you have one.
- Unplug the power, wait 60 seconds, and plug it back in.
